Explore History

Wilmington is full of rich history. It is home to a WWII battleship called the “Battleship North Carolina,” where visitors can walk the deck and explore. You can learn firsthand about the ship’s history—and even those who lived in its hull.

Alternatively, you could spend another afternoon at the Wilmington Railroad Museum, learning about the railroad industry’s long history in the city with an up-close look at old trains. Your tour includes a walk through a couple trains as you learn what it was like to live and work in the rail system.

Walk Along the River

One of the unique draws of Wilmington is the walkway that runs along the Cape Fear River. This paved trail is a beautiful place to enjoy warm weather, get exercise, and feel the breeze off the water. 

In addition to the walkway, the river is lined with various shops, restaurants, boutiques, and even outdoor concert venues. Whether you want to window shop, grab a coffee, or just enjoy the company of others, you can find what you’re looking for along the riverfront.

Walk the Grounds at Airlie Gardens

There’s no better place to spend a sunny afternoon than Airlie Gardens. The 67- acre estate is filled with walking paths, artwork, flowers, and greenery. Other independent living residents can often be found on outings in Airlie Gardens, enjoying the wildlife or having an afternoon picnic.  The gardens are a wonderful place to bring a book to relax alone or spend time with others as a social activity.
